FSSAI warns against using newspapers to pack food items
Source: Chronicle News Service
Imphal, January 04 2025:
The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I) has issued a warning against usage of newspapers for packing, serving, and storing food items due to significant health risks.
According to FSSAI, roadside vendors, local hotels and vendors regularly use newspapers to wrap the foot items.
However, it highlighted that the ink used in newspapers contains harmful materials including bioactive substances which can contaminate the food and cause serious health issues.
Thus, FSSAI directed the state food authorities to closely monitor the matter and take up all necessary responsibilities.
Meanwhile, despite knowing that using newspapers to pack the food items is harmful to health, in Manipur's context, no particular body had spread awareness of the same or taken up requisite measures.
